Reception - Making Pasta!

Cooking has many benefits; not only do you get a nice meal at the end of it, but it's a way for children to experiment with Maths concepts such as counting and measuring, enhance their fine-motor skills through grating and cutting, and explore the idea of healthy eating in a much more creative way. Our Reception students had a lot of fun in the cafeteria where they had a go at making some healthy pasta, and judging by their smiling faces, they certainly had a good time!
